Also as your critique buddy, I shall put a critique hat on.
I think the backgrounds are the best part on this page, and the expressions are very nice! But the problem is that day/night colors are basically the same. Without the day and night panel, I couldn't tell if it changes. You can solve this by adding darker shadows, using blu-ish tones, or even a blue overlay :'D
And thanks for the feedback too! I definitely agree about the colours. I do use overlays, but maybe I'm a bit cautious with it. Next time I do a night scene I'll use your advice and maybe try out more different layer types 0w0
